Spatial modulation of the order parameter for the ground state of superconductors in polar systems

Description
Based on the experimental observation that the recently discovered T* phases in ceramic superconductors are polar, this paper shows that polarity implies that the ground state has a spatial modulation of the phase of the order parameter, provided this polar direction also breaks time reversal symmetry. This gives rise to experimentally testable predictions for the T* phase including an oscillatory dependence of the thickness of the insulating layer for the AC and DC Josephson effect in contrast to the monotonic dependence for classical superconductors
